Hantek 2C42 (2d42 / 2c72 / 2d72)


Случилось невероятное! Hantek выпустил новую линейку приборов! Портативный осциллограф, который просто складывает как детей всякие DSO, JINHAN-ы и других конкурентов. При этом стоимость прибора соизмерима. Это лидер на сегодня в своей нише и ценовой категории!



Hantek 2C42  — это 2-х канальный цифровой осциллограф, с частотой дискретизации на один канал 250Msps/s. При этом замечу, что оба канала аналоговые. Сам прибор представляет собой комбайн и имеет в составе еще мультиметр на 4000 отсчетов и генератор сигналов в D-версиях.

Hantek2c42


Прибор исключительно удобен тем — кому надо оборудование на выезде и важна мобильность. Занимает места немного. Форм фактор обычного добротного мультиметра. Те кто испытывает просто дефицит рабочего пространства так же останется доволен! Для переноски имеется удобная сумочка-кейс. Прибор выполнен в прочном качественном пластике одетом в резиновую калошу. Качество резины так же высокое и покоцать прибор или сломать физически будет сложнее.


Отвязку от питающей сети и автономность обеспечивают 2 аккумулятора форм-фактора 18650 емкостью 2600mAh. Включены они в параллель и емкость суммируется. Судя по самим аккумам суммарная емкость батаери будет не менее 5000mAh! Это даст приличный запас по автономной работе. Забудьте про зарядник! В отличие от DSO в которых зачастую стоит 500mAh аккум. 


Органы управления прибора исключительно кнопки. Нет никаких вращающихся энкодеров, что наверное небольшой минус. Правда, это не мешает работать комфортно с прибором даже на столе. В полевых условиях — важно увидеть хоть что-то хоть как-то. Своего рода компромисс, особенно учитывая цену. Стоимость начинается от 100$ младшая модель и до 170$  — старшая. Ниже можно увидеть модельный ряд, он состоит из 4 моделей:



Я лично брал прибор самой младшей модели 2C42. Мне интересен только осциллограф. Мультиметр достался «бонусом». Учитывая то, что DSO стоят столько же, где только осциллограф, при этом хуже по заявленным параметрам, а JINHAN — еще и дороже (120-130$)! И тоже хуже, так как имеет один аналоговый канал, менее юзабельны. 


Экран прибора выполнен на обычной TFT матрице. Углы обзоры средние, но цвета подобраны хорошо! Изображение контрастное и легко читаемое. В прошивке предусмотрены таймауты подсветки (2 уровня), а так же уровень свечения экрана. Мне достаточно 7-9. Всего уровней — 10.


Прошивка Hantek 2000

Прошивка прибора за все время, что он у меня, ни разу не лагнула, не вылетела. Никаких неточностей или недоработок я не заметил. Все заявленные функции работают так как от них ожидается. Если бы на панели прибора не было написано Hantek я бы наверное не поверил, что это Хантек. 


Управление программной частью интуитивно понятное, без инструкции можно разобраться за 15 минут. Функций немного, но для мобильного девайса вполне достаточно — есть все необходимое. 


Я уже скачал на сайте обновленную прошивку и закатал в прибор через USB кабель. Никаких дополнительных устройств не требуется. Никаких сложностей. Еще, что удивило — прошивка открыта. Бинарный код не зашифрован и заливается в STM-ку через обычный DFU. 


Так же имеется возможность отдельно обновить и прошивку и конфигурацию FPGA. 


Считаю это просто огромным, жирным плюсом! Так как ремонтопригодность такого устройства практически 100%! Если слетит прошивка — ее всегда можно накатить обратно, вплоть до того, что перепаяв сам микроконтроллер. Остальное железо все так же меняется. Внутрь заглянем позже.


При удачном раскладе так же прошивку можно и поотлаживать и дизассемблировать! Попытаться превратить прибор в D-версию — но все это темы для другой статьи. Так же я бы например изменил цвет сетки, на более тусклый. Но это нюансы. И это впереди.


Технические характеристики

ModelHantek2D72Hantek2D42Hantek2C72Hantek2C42
Oscilloscope Mode
Bandwidth70MHz40MHz70MHz40MHz
Channel2CH+DMM+AWG2CH+DMM+AWG2CH+DMM2CH+DMM
Horizontal
Sample Rate Range250MSa/s(Single-channel), 125MSa/s(Dual-channel)
Waveform Interpolation(sin x)/x
Record LengthMax. 6K for single-channel; 3K samples per dual-channel
SEC/DIV Range5ns/div~500s/div  1, 2, 5 sequence
Vertical
A/D Converter8-bit resolution,each channel sampled simultaneously
VOLTS/DIV Range10mV/div~10V/divat input BNC
Bandwidth Limit, typical20MHz
Low Frequency Response (-3db)≤10Hz at BNC
Rise Time at BNC, typical≤5ns
DC Gain Accuracy±3% for Normal or Average acquisition mode, 10V/div to 10mV/div
Note: Bandwidth reduced to 6MHz when using a 1X probe.
Acquisition
Acquisition ModesNormal
Trigger
TypeEdge
ModeAuto, Normal, single
Level±4 divisions from center of screen
Trigger Level Accuracy0.2div × volts/div within ±4 divisions from center of screen   
SlopeRising, Falling, Rising & Falling
SourceCH1/CH2
Input
CouplingDC, AC or GND
Input Impedance, 25pF±3 pF, 1MΩ±2%
DC coupled
Probe Attenuation1X, 10X
Supported Probe Attenuation Factors1X, 10X, 100X, 1000X
Maximum Input Voltage150VRMS
Measurement
CursorVoltage difference between cursors: △V
Time difference between cursors: △T
Automatic MeasurementsFrequency, Amplitude
Arbitrary Waveform Generator Mode
Waveform FrequencySine: 1Hz~25MHz          -          -
Square: 1Hz~10MHz          -          -
Ramp: 1Hz~1MHz          -          -
EXP: 1Hz~5MHz          -          -
Sampling250MSa/s          -          -
Amplitude2.5Vpp(50Ω)          -          -
5Vpp(High impedance)          -          -
Frequency Resolution0.10%          -          -
Channel1CH waveform output          -          -
Waveform Depth512Sa          -          -
Vertical Resolution12 bit          -          -
Output Impedance50 Ω          -          -
DMM
Maximum Resolution4000 Counts
DMM Testing ModesVoltage,Current,Resistance,Capacitance,Diode &On-Off
Maximum Input VoltageAC:600V, DC: 800V
Maximum Input CurrentAC: 10A, DC:10A
Input Impedance10MΩ
Measurement TermRangeAccuracyResolution
DC Voltage400.00mV± (0.8% + 5)100uV
4.000V1mV
40.00V10mV
400.0V100mV
600.0V± (1% + 2)1V
Overload protection: 400mV: 250V, other: 600Vrms.
AC Voltage4.000V± (1.2% + 5)1mV
40.00V10mV
400.0V100mV
600.0V±(1.5% + 5)1V
Frequency: 40Hz~400Hz;
Frequency of 400V and 600V: 40Hz~100Hz
DC Current40.00mA± (1% + 2)10uA
200.0mA± (1.5% + 2)100uA
4.000A± (1.8% + 2)1mA
10.00A± (3% + 2)10mA
Overload protection: 
self restoring fuse: 200mA/250V, 4A and 10A range no fuse.
AC Current40.00mA± (1.3% + 2)10uA
400.0mA± (1.8% + 2)100uA
4.000A± (2% + 3)1mA
10.00A± (3% + 5)10mA
Frequency: 40Hz~400Hz;
self restoring fuse: 200mA/250V, 4A and 10A range no fuse.
Resistance400.0Ω±(1% + 3)0.1Ω
4.000KΩ±(1.2% + 5)
60.00KΩ10Ω
400.0KΩ100Ω
4.000MΩ1KΩ
40.00MΩ± (1.5%±3)10KΩ
Overload protection: 220Vrms
Capacitance40.00nF±(3% + 5)10pF
400.0nF100pF
4.000uF1nF
40.00uF10nF
100.0uF100nF
Overload protection: 220Vrms
Diode0V~2.0V
On-Off<50Ω
General Specifications
Display
Display Type2.8 inch64K color TFT
Display Resolution320 horizontal by 240 vertical pixels
Display ContrastAdjustable
Power Supply
Supply Voltage100V-240VAC, 50Hz-60Hz; DC INPUT: 5VDC, 2A
Power Consumption<2.5W
FuseT, 3A
Battery2600mA*2
Environmental
Operating Temperature0~50 °C (32~122 °F)
Storage Temperature-40~+71 °C (-40~159.8 °F)
Humidity≤+104℉(≤+40°C): ≤90% relative humidity
106℉~122℉ (+41°C ~50°C): ≤60% relative humidity
Cooling MethodConvection
AltitudeOperating and3,000m (10,000 feet)
Nonoperating
Mechanical ShockRandom Vibration0.31gRMS from 50Hz to 500Hz, 10 minutes on each axis
Nonoperating2.46gRMS from 5Hz to 500Hz, 10 minutes on each axis
Operating50g, 11ms, half sine
Mechanical
Dimension199 x 98x 40mm (L x W x H)
Weight624g
Standard AccessoriesProbe*1,Clip Probe*2, Type Charging Cable*1, Power Adapter*1, Multimeter Probe*1Probe*1,Clip Probe*2, Type Charging Cable*1, Power Adapter*1, Multimeter Probe*1Probe*1,Clip Probe*1, Type Charging Cable*1, Power Adapter*1,  Multimeter Probe*1Probe*1,Clip Probe*1, Type Charging Cable*1, Power Adapter*1, Multimeter Probe*1

 




Купить Hantek: Hantek 2000

4 комментария

igelizm
Доброго здравия! Подписался и выкачал весь канал. Как я понял вы спец по осциллографам до самых прошивок. Мне нужен больше как регистратор чтобы мог сохранять записи с периодом 200-500сек на клетку. Чтобы в одном графике было отображено суточное изменение напряжения. Я измеряю ЭМИ и сигнал беру с выхода измерителей напряжённости поля. Пока использую АЦП и софт от ИБП Поверком. И не могу решиться какой для этой цели лучше взять- 2С42 или 1013 https://aliexpress.ru/item/4000861098295.html И можно ли поправить прошивку чтобы увеличить период и время записи?
nick
ну не то чтобы уже прямо суперспец… так, немножко. Если у вас стоит задача регистратора — проще сделать вообще отдельное устройство. Так как скорость дискретизации не будет иметь особого значения (если импульс длиинный) и можно более точно снимать показания, например, используя встроенный в STM32 12-битный АЦП вместо 8 битного в осциллографе. Заложить свой «триггер» и другую логику — конкретно под задачу. Править прошивку дольше чем сделать что-то такое свое. У осциллографов есть режим ROLL. Так вот в том же Хантеке 2cXX можно выставить как раз до 500 сек / клетку. Это да. Только там всего 12 клеток на экране и сутки там не поместятся. последние полтора часа — можно. Но для импульса не подойдет так как он короткий. Вы его просто не словите в нужный момент и график будет всегда прямой. Ну или играться как-то с триггером в обычном режиме с единичным захватом — тогда просто будет индикатор «был импульс или нет». И только один, в неизвестное время. В общем надо думать
igelizm
Доброго здравия! Да дизасм прошивки для меня это запредельное мастерство. Я даже с ардуиной ещё не умею совладать. Заказал такой модуль (жаль нельзя картинки вставлять) https://aliexpress.ru/item/4000271895955.html — тут парсер надо поправить чтоб расширение целиком включал в ссылку. вобщем там и память и часы. ещё б экран добавить и был бы регистратор. но я это могу даже за зиму не написать пока всё изучу. есть самодельный DSO138 но у него памяти мало и выгрузки нет. ну и скроллить график сильно долго. мне бы желательно сохранять в .csf как ИБП под которую написал прогу на Лазарусе для отображения и разложения по Фурье на частоты - https://vk.com/photo51678172_456243289 
Тут картина какая- от вышек связи идут импульсы, которые не видят обычные приборы так как усредняют. Они складываются в синусы с периодом 40 сек, а из них формируются инфраНЧ синусоиды которые видно только на длинных развёртках. вот как выглядит на 138м https://vk.com/photo51678172_456243787 и сигналы эти год назад были только по праздникам, затем стали по выходным, а с начала пандемии каждый день по хитрому расписанию которое я и хочу вычислить. Сами импульсы эти очень мощные что даже дозиметры их видят, о чём в ютюбе много роликов мол с вышек рентген жарит. Но как я думаю это наводки от ЭМИ на схему. В импульсном режиме видимо передатчики позволяют максимум мощи выдавать. 
И в итоге выявляется такая сетка ИНЧ частот очень широкого спектра https://vk.com/photo51678172_457247371 Зачем они я и хочу выяснить. Для меня как радиолюбителя увидеть такую картину вместо обычных пакетов цифровой связи было открытием. и остаётся загадкой как будто числовую радиостанцию поймал о которой никто не знает.
И для понимания нужен мобильный прибор который можно оставлять в разных местах у вышек для сбора и анализа данных. Желательно с экраном чтобы по нему можно было мониторить начало этих пакетов синусов когда он будет дома. 
Сперва думал что 2С42 может в память сохранять логи в .csf но как оказалось только в программе.
Может заинтересовал темой и попробуете сами понаблюдать? Для приёма  всего спектра до 8ггц у меня такой модуль на AD8318 https://www.aliexpress.com/item/1-8000MHz-AD8318-RF-Logarithmic-Detector-70dB-RSSI-Measurement-Power-Meter-Board-module/1005001597554950.html но пойдёт любой до 1ггц так как эти волны передают на несущей 900мгц- там видимо свободных каналов больше, мало у кого остались кнопочные трубки 2Ж связи.

ЗЫЖ по сайту ещё баг- при нажатии на регистрацию открывается вход, приходится открывать по ссылке. Ну и время сессии бы продлить, каждый день капчу вбивать надоест многим.
igelizm
Вот к такому бы экранчику логгер написать… https://aliexpress.ru/item/32583491591.html?spm=a2g0o.productlist.0.0.13b17e3bHII98P
Получится бутер из трёх плат- ардуинка, часы-карта и экран